Abstract

The invention provides a covert communication method and device, and the method comprises the steps: obtaining a to-be-exchanged model parameter between a client participating in federated learning and a server, embedding covert data into the to-be-exchanged model parameter between the client participating in federated learning and the server, and obtaining a target model parameter, so that hidden data are hidden in to-be-interacted model parameters, it is guaranteed that the hidden data are not likely to be perceived; on this basis, sending the target model parameters to the client or the server, so the effective hidden communication between the client and the server is guaranteed while it is guaranteed that the source model is not affected.

technical field [0001] The present application relates to the technical field of communication, and in particular to a covert communication method and device. Background technique [0002] With the advent of the era of big data, data has become an important resource, and the exchange, sharing and full utilization of data is the core goal of realizing the value of big data and improving the efficiency of big data. Therefore, the demand for data exchange and sharing between different domains is becoming more and more urgent. However, there are data barriers that are difficult to break between different domains. With the introduction of the Internet of Things, it is difficult for data to be directly shared and exchanged across domains, resulting in the current big data becoming more and more "data islands" in a sense, unable to truly play the value of big data analysis and mining.
